The holes caused by nails or screws can easily successfully repair - affirms Philip Fischer, Head of Customer Solutions. The repair method is dependent upon the tire is punctured. If sharp, elongated object is stuck with a right angle, shall apply only unique pin of flexible plastic material. The screw must become removed, and then put in its place a special foraminifera, preparing to mount flag hole. Tyre repair extruded opening, which then puts a device resembling an item of cable. Excess projecting above the tread is cut using a knife, leaving between cuts around. 2-3 mm pin. Corks old type require lubrication glue. Modern are made of your viscous material, which abuts the roll and prevents the evade of air outwards. - For such repairs you may not even need to download the wheels of the axle. This was necessary if your hole pins flights had been called mushrooms, which from the within the tire - explains Philip Fischer. When the pin just isn't enough In the case of holes on the sidewall of the roll, or when the bolt entered in to the rubber at an serious angle, apply patches. Then you need to remove the tire from the rim, and the patch is glued through the inside. Today's kits do definitely not require hot glue, already after a couple of minutes the patch adheres strongly enough to mount the tire on the rim and inflated. Typical cure, or patching defects rubber on hot, in principle, no longer applied. Philip Fischer points away that even professional repair restore never tire hundred percent fitness before the injury. - Only prevent even more deflation. While the naked eyes cannot see, puncture or cut four tires can weaken the material strand circumscribing the wire. The tire more quickly consumes it then, and in many cases can bring about output cord out -- says Philip Fischer. Therefore, any mechanical damage are synonymous using a loss of warranty.
